Job Title: Data Engineer

Location: New York City, NY (Onsite)

Duration: 12+ Months

 

Job Description: Summary:

The main function of the Data Engineer is to develop, evaluate, test and maintain architectures and data solutions within our organization. The typical Data Engineer executes plans, policies, and practices that control, protect, deliver, and enhance the value of the organization’s data assets.

 

MUST Have experience:

  • Coding experience (Python required; SQL strongly preferred)
  • Some hardware data experience. Sensor data collection
  • Experience with hardware/sensor data and data collection (e.g., IMU/EMG/optical or similar)
  • Debugging/troubleshooting ability across software and hardware interfaces, with a focus on data quality and reliability.

 

Nice to Have skills

  • Additional years/depth of engineering experience beyond the minimum level
  • Signal processing experience (especially time-domain signals such as EMG/IMU).
  • Scientific computing experience and experience working with large, high-dimensional datasets

 

Job Responsibilities:

  • Design, plan, and execute data collection studies, working closely with research and product teams to gather high-quality biosensor data.
  • Monitor and maintain the quality and integrity of large datasets, implementing robust data validation, cleaning, and quality custom/specialized monitoring processes for multiple sensor streams (IMU, EMG, optical sensors, etc).
  • Debug and troubleshoot firmware and software issues related to data collection, ensuring reliable data acquisition from hardware sensors.
  • Execute, debug, and optimize distributed compute workflows for metric computation and analysis across large datasets.
  • Build, modify, and maintain custom/specialized benchmarking tools, frameworks, and flows for evaluating and comparing model performance on large datasets.
  • Generate and test hypotheses and analyze and interpret the results of data collection experiments.
  • Leverage data visualization to help the team make decisions.

 

Skills:

  • Experience with hardware sensors, data collection infrastructure, and data analysis pertaining to real-world human data.
  • Experience with signal processing pertaining to time domain signals and/or medical imaging systems.
  • Experience working with and managing large, high-dimensional datasets.
  • 2+ years of experience performing data extraction, manipulation, and visualization using Python and SQL.
  • Strong debugging skills, particularly related to data acquisition and firmware/software interfaces.
  • Experience with Javascript/Typescript for front-end UI development.
  • Experience with scientific computing and analysis packages such as NumPy, SciPy, Pandas.
  • Experience with data visualization libraries such as Matplotlib, Pyplot, Seaborn, ggplot2.

 

Education/Experience:

• Bachelor's or Master of Science degree in computer science, electrical engineering, statistics, neuroscience, biomedical engineering, or other relevant field is required.
